The controller for controlling temperature devices MCK 301-61 is designed to control indoor climate devices and perform the following functions:
controls temperature by means of two independent thermal sensors;
indicates the average temperature in the room;
monitors the health and manages the operation of two independent air conditioners;
turns off all climate devices when a fire signal is received;
Monitors and reports malfunctions of temperature sensors.
The device supports the following operating modes:
thermostat mode with connected heater;
thermostat mode with air conditioning zone control;
alarm mode;
test mode.
LEDs are displayed on the front panel of the device indicating:
"COMP" - turning on / off the air conditioner No. 1;
"FAN" - turning on / off the air conditioner No. 2;
"DEF" - turn on / off the electric heater;
"SET" - parameter setting mode
A three-digit seven-segment indicator and four control buttons displayed on the front panel allow you to set and control the following parameters:
average air temperature within 0 - 35 ° C;
thermostat operating mode;
backup air conditioner operation mode;
programmable time delay for turning off the backup air conditioner 0 - 60 Min;
lower temperature limit;
two upper temperature limits;
temperature sensor error correction value;
the value of the upper and lower emergency temperature;
upper and lower threshold of the conditioning zone;
minimum turn-on and turn-off time of climate devices;
fire sensor analysis resolution;
access password for the user and for the installer.
